Objectives of the Course
To provide students with a foundational understanding of computer-aided 3D modeling concepts and tools. To teach students how to create and modify 3D models using professional CAD software. To develop students' ability to generate technical drawings and representations of 3D models. To familiarize students with surface and solid modeling techniques. To apply 3D modeling skills to solve real-world engineering problems, particularly in shipbuilding and mechanical engineering.

Course Contents
This course introduces students to the principles and techniques of computer-aided 3D modeling, with a focus on applications in engineering design and production. Students will learn to use professional 3D modeling software to create, modify, and optimize complex 3D objects. The course emphasizes practical applications in industries such as shipbuilding, mechanical engineering, and industrial design, helping students develop essential skills in technical drawing, surface modeling, solid modeling, and rendering.
